How to Unlock Superman in Fortnite

To get the Superman skin, players must own the Chapter 6 Season 3 Battle Pass. This Battle Pass costs 1,000 V-Bucks or is available via the Fortnite Crew subscription. Once activated, players need to gain 12 account levels from July 11 onward—progress from earlier in the season won’t count.

This ensures that everyone starts fresh, and players who want to play as Superman will need to earn their stripes (or in this case, capes) all over again.

Free Superman-Themed Rewards Available

Not all of the Superman rewards are locked behind the Battle Pass. Even players without a subscription can unlock four themed cosmetics simply by leveling up:

  • The Confrontation (Loading Screen) – Earn 4 levels
  • Super Cape (Back Bling) – Earn 10 levels
  • Superman Banner Icon – Earn 16 levels
  • Crystal Smasher (Pickaxe) – Earn 22 levels

These items let all players share in the Superman celebration—no Battle Pass required.

All Superman Cosmetics and Easter Eggs

In total, there are 12 unique Superman cosmetics available through progression starting July 11. The complete set includes the Superman skin, the Daily Flight Glider (which he lifts heroically), and the Pen & Ink variant designed by legendary DC artist Jim Lee.

One of the standout details is Superman’s flight animation—when gliding, he stretches out one arm in classic superhero fashion. These small touches elevate the experience, making the skin more than just a costume—it’s a tribute to DC’s cinematic reboot.
